Position Summary

As a Washing Crew Worker, you will support the maintenance of our poultry houses, ensuring they meet the highest standards of hygiene, bio‑security, and animal welfare. You will work closely with the veterinary and production teams to keep our facilities clean, safe, and ready for daily operations.

Key Responsibilities

  • Wash poultry houses to meet regulatory requirements.
  • Assist with vaccination, selection, and transfer of birds.
  • Apply lime salt mixtures to designated areas.
  • Ensure all visitors comply with site bio‑security procedures.
  • Fumigate all equipment and items entering and exiting the site.
  • Maintain ground conditions (cutting grass, weeding, and cleaning electric fences).
  • Follow all bio‑security protocols at all times.
  • Adhere to 20 Keys standards and animal welfare standards during bird transfer or depopulation.
  • Maintain compliance with OHSA (Occupational Health and Safety Act) standards.
  • Support overall product quality, hygiene, and bio‑security efforts.
